6 Carters Road, Epsom, KT17 4NE is a freehold semi-detached property built between 1900-1929. The property offers approximately 689 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have two b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£506,997 , which equates to approximately £736 per square foot. It was last sold on 19 Nov 2020 for £435,000. Since then, the value has increased by £71,997, representing a 16.6% increase, or approximately 3.0% per year.

The current estimated value of £506,997 is:

  • 4.7% lower than the average property price on Carters Road
  • 1.0% higher than the average in the KT17 4NE postcode area
  • and 19.1% lower than the average price for Epsom as a whole

This property has had 2 EPC inspections with recorded tenure information. It was recorded as owner-occupied both times. This suggests the property has typically been lived in by its owners, which often reflects longer-term residency and more consistent maintenance.

At the most recent EPC inspection on 17 June 2020, the property was recorded as owner-occupied.

6 Carters Road, Epsom, Epsom And Ewell, Surrey, KT17 4NE has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of E, based on the latest assessment carried out on 17 Jun 2020.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 13 Apr 2012. The rating of E is unchanged, though the energy efficiency score decreased by 6.1%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, 100 mm loft insulation to pitched, 200 mm loft insulation, improving energy efficiency from average to good.
  • The wall construction or insulation changed from solid brick, as built, no insulation (assumed) to cavity wall, as built, no insulation (assumed), improving energy efficiency from very poor to poor.
  • The windows were upgraded from some secondary glazing to fully double glazed.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 75%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 55% of fixed outlets, with efficiency changing from very good to good.
